From eff9ecf7cda7fb12717ce1131967fcb10d695d6f Mon Sep 17 00:00:00 2001 From: WerWolv Date: Sun, 14 Aug 2022 19:11:49 +0200 Subject: [PATCH] fix: Crash when closing provider tab Fixes #674 --- plugins/builtin/source/content/ui_items.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/plugins/builtin/source/content/ui_items.cpp b/plugins/builtin/source/content/ui_items.cpp index 8367aa31b..79f3f302b 100644 --- a/plugins/builtin/source/content/ui_items.cpp +++ b/plugins/builtin/source/content/ui_items.cpp @@ -332,7 +332,7 @@ namespace hex::plugin::builtin { bool open = true; ImGui::PushID(tabProvider); - if (ImGui::BeginTabItem(tabProvider->getName().c_str(), &open, provider->isDirty() ? ImGuiTabItemFlags_UnsavedDocument : ImGuiTabItemFlags_None)) { + if (ImGui::BeginTabItem(tabProvider->getName().c_str(), &open, tabProvider->isDirty() ? ImGuiTabItemFlags_UnsavedDocument : ImGuiTabItemFlags_None)) { ImHexApi::Provider::setCurrentProvider(i); ImGui::EndTabItem(); }